Two new homes ready for tenants in Cowbit

cowbit homesTenants will soon be able to enjoy two brand new homes in Cowbit.

The properties have recently been completed and will be rented to tenants of South Holland District Council.

The two bedroom homes have been built in Stonegate by D Brown Builders Ltd and were handed over to councillors at the site last week.

The buildings have energy efficient systems including air source heating and will be made available to tenants from the council’s housing waiting list.

Christine Lawton, the council’s portfolio holder for housing, said: “This is one of several sites that have been transformed into housing over the last eight years.

“We have been aiming to develop un-used garden areas and garage sites.

“This helps to fill areas in the housing stock that are in high demand, such as two bedroom family homes.”
